Strawberry Hill is a station where practicality meets a touch of historic charm. Travelers can purchase tickets and collect them via the available ticket machines. Open from early morning, the ticket office is manned every day of the week, though hours are shorter during the weekends. Ticket machines are equipped to handle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ring accessibility for all.
Platforms are fitted with accessible ticket machines and customer help points, though it is important to note that there might be no staff assistance at the station. However, the presence of smartcard validators makes entry and exit straightforward for regular commuters using contactless smartcards.
Although the waiting room is currently under refurbishment, there's a seating area on Platform 2 where you can relax until your train arrives. For those in need of a caffeine fix or a quick snack, the station features a coffee shop on Platform 2, providing a delightful pause in a busy day. While the station lacks toilets and baby-changing facilities, its clean and open environment compensates for these limitations.
Strawberry Hill station is perfectly positioned for those needing onward travel services. For routes disrupted by rail issues, there is a well-organized rail replacement service with specific bus stops designated for travelers between Teddington and Twickenham. Not to forget, a dedicated taxi office is conveniently located on Platform 2, allowing for easy planning for further travel. Bus services connect the station to local destinations, with more details accessible in printable format to aid in planning your journey.

Halling station might not boast a grand array of facilities, but it provides essential services to ensure a smooth journey. The station doesn’t have a ticket office, however, it offers ticket machines where you can collect tickets booked online. These machines are accessible and located at the entrance to platform 1. Passengers with hearing impairments will appreciate the induction loops available on-site.
While the station lacks amenities such as lounges, toilets, and shops, there are seating areas available for passengers to wait comfortably. Unfortunately, for those requiring step-free access, it is important to highlight that while platform 1 for services to Strood offers step-free access, platform 2 towards Paddock Wood does not.
Connections from Halling station make exploring the broader region straightforward and convenient. The station links well with various modes of public transport, including buses. If you're looking to continue your journey by bus, local Arriva buses serve destinations towards Maidstone and Strood, with stops conveniently located near the station.
